About
Gavi Gangadhareshwara Temple, also known as Gavipuram Cave Temple or Gavipuram Guttahalli Temple, is a revered pilgrimage centre dedicated to Lord Shiva in the Gavipuram area of Bengaluru, Karnataka.

How to reach
By road
- From Kempegowda Bus Station (Majestic): Take a city bus or auto-rickshaw towards Chamarajpet, then proceed to Gavipuram Extension in Kempegowda Nagar.
- Via Namma Metro: Take the Green Line to National College Metro Station. The temple is approximately 1.2–1.5 km away; take an auto-rickshaw or walk from there.
